Ancient Retail Wisdom: The First Branded Products
Before modern malls and e-commerce, ancient civilizations had sophisticated marketplaces and branded goods. From Mesopotamian merchant seals to Roman mass production techniques, the foundations of product marketing and consumer trends were established thousands of years ago. This poll explores how ancient entrepreneurs differentiated their products in the earliest marketplaces of human civilization.
